Charlesbye is looking for a bright, ambitious and motivated individual with a background in media and communications, to join our thriving integrated communications and public affairs team.

Founded by former No10 comms chiefs Lee Cain and Lucia Hodgson, Charlesbye is a full-service strategic communications company, with a client roster that includes some of the world's biggest and most exciting brands. 

We’re looking for an experienced and organised individual to join our Borough office who has previously worked in the media, communications consultancies, press offices or media-facing roles, and are now looking to take their next step in a competitive and growing agency.
